OverviewIt's important that we all learn to care for and nurture our mental health! This is a kids’ book about mental health. Did you know it's something we all have? It's true! A person's mental health simply means how they understand their own thoughts, feelings, actions and interactions with others. This book was made to help kids aged 5-9 identify and understand their own mental health. It teaches them that sometimes our mental health is positive, and other times it's not. Learning that we all have mental health reminds us that we aren't alone. And [...] leaves you that space for exploration and discussion. -- Patrice Lawrence, writer-in-residence * BookTrust * Author InformationDr. Katie Lingras (she/her) is a child psychologist who is passionate about improving the lives of young children and their families. Like Mr. Rogers, Dr. Katie thrives on making hard topics “mentionable” for kids and grownups. Dr. Katie lives in Minneapolis, Minnesota, with her family, and supports her own mental health by singing, running, and adventuring around the world!
